Another factor which Bruce Pile referred to above, is Net Energy. How much energy does it take to produce the energy providing substance. In the early days of the oil business, the energy in one barrrel of oil would enable the production of up to 100 barrels of oil. Now it runs about 1 to 3. The energy required to produce a gallon of ethanol is as much or more than gallon of ethanol produces. Subsidy or no, that is not a sustainable situation. The production of energy neeeds to be looked at as not just monetary ecnomics, but in terms of energy economics. What is the energy profit (or loss) from the method. Currently most of the alternative methods do not produce energy protfits, and some produce energy losses by the time they are at the end user.

The new find in the Gulf at 25,000 feet may be reported as BOE, but it is extremely highly unlikely that any hydrocarbons at that depth will produce as oil. At that depth, the reserves are much more likely to be natural gas, of which there is a significant surplus due to the shale gas technology.

BP's find at 25k feet is hardly likely to be oil. At that depth, the termperature and pressure cook the hydocarbons into natural gas, not oil. BP carefull refer to BOE, or barrels of oil equivalent in their press release. Natural gas in in oversupply, and selling for $3 per mcf or less at the well head. It is hghly unlikely that wells like BP's can be affordably drilled and produced at these natural gas prices.

I am in the oil business, and when I hedge, I do not take possession of the oil that I do a futures contract on, nor do I ship my production to Cushing, Oklahoma where contracted oil is stored, nor do other oil companies that I know. If my oil does not sell for the price that I hedge it for, I sell it at market where it is, and make up the difference with the profit or loss from my hedge that month, with the net result being that I net the price that I hedged, thus keeping my bank happy. Similarly the buyer of oil who hedges, does not normally take possession of the oil in Cushing, but buys it in the normal course of his business, using the profit or loss on his hedge to end up with the net price hedged.

A new study of the subsidy program implemented by Spain (which Obama cites as a good model) reveals that every new job created by the Spanish government in the alternative energy area destroyed an average of 2.2 other jobs. The study – prepared under the direction of Dr. Gabriel Calzada, an economics professor at Juan Carlos University in Madrid – discovered that only one in 10 jobs created by the program in Spain were of a permanent nature (operations, maintenance, etc.), and two-thirds consisted of temporary jobs in construction, fabrication and installation. Spain has spent about $774,000 to create each “green job” since 2000, including subsidies of more than $1.3 million per wind industry job. However, about 113,000 other jobs elsewhere in the Spanish economy were destroyed because of the subsidies, or 2.2 jobs destroyed for every “green job” created.

The savings and loan fiasco and related massive write offs occurred because Congress overruled accounting profession rules and passed a law that enabled S&Ls to write off their losses from the Carter high interest rates over 20 years, instead of when incurred. However, since they were mostly lawyers who were ignorant of accounting, they placed no restrictions on the retained earnings account, which was massively overstated due to the unrecorded losses. It was not very long until some unscrupulous operators acquired the S&Ls for their negligible value, made loans with big upfront fees, and paid out the fees in dividends. They made money whether the loans were ever paid back or not. That is the result of lawmakers overruling the accounting profession.
